Trump Claims Iran Halting Executions Amid Protests; Tehran Asserts 'Full Control'
- •President Trump stated Iran has stopped plans for fast trials and executions, citing "good authority" amid widespread protests.
- •Iran Human Rights reported over 3,400 protest-related deaths, while Human Rights Activists News Agency cited 2,586 fatalities.
- •Iranian Foreign Minister Abbas Araghchi denied any immediate executions, claiming the government is in "full control" after a "terrorist operation."
- •The US began withdrawing personnel from regional military bases, and the UK temporarily closed its Tehran embassy due to security concerns.
- •G7 nations expressed alarm over reported deaths and injuries, warning of further sanctions; India and other countries advised citizens to leave Iran.
